Legal?

In Scotland, only a Marriage Ceremony has legal standing; all other ceremonies are non-legal.

Who?

For Life Ceremonies, you can invite anyone you like. Unlike a legal wedding ceremony, which requires two witnesses over the age of 16, Life Ceremonies are flexible and do not require witnesses.

What type of Life Ceremonies are available?

 

 

BlessingWay Ceremonies

Blessingway ceremonies are special gatherings that honour a pregnant mother and the journey toward parenthood. Rooted in tradition and filled with love and support, these ceremonies focus on nurturing the expectant mother, celebrating their transition into this new chapter of life. Blessingways provide a space for family and friends to share wisdom, offer blessings, and express their hopes for a healthy birth, creating a strong sense of community and connection.

 

Celebrating New Life

New Life ceremonies, like a Baby Naming or Baby Blessing, are powerful rituals that celebrate the arrival of a child and their place in the family and community. These ceremonies are filled with love, joy, and hope, symbolising the start of a new chapter. They offer a moment to bestow meaningful names, share blessings, and set intentions for the child's future, creating a lasting bond among family, friends, and the little one.

Coming of Age 

Coming of Age ceremonies are significant milestones that mark a young person's transition into a new stage of life. These ceremonies celebrate growth, maturity, and the journey toward adulthood, acknowledging the achievements and responsibilities that come with it. They offer an opportunity to honour traditions, share wisdom, and express hopes for the future, creating a meaningful connection between the individual, their family, and their community.

Graduation Ceremonies

Graduation ceremonies are powerful celebrations that signify the completion of an important chapter in one's educational journey. These ceremonies mark the culmination of hard work, dedication, and growth, highlighting both achievements and new beginnings. They provide an opportunity to honour the graduates’ accomplishments, acknowledge the support of family and friends, and inspire hope and excitement for the future, creating lasting memories for everyone involved.

Betrothal Ceremonies

Betrothal ceremonies are meaningful rituals that celebrate the commitment between two people as they promise to marry. These ceremonies mark the beginning of a new journey, filled with love, trust, and shared dreams. They offer an opportunity to honour cultural traditions, exchange meaningful vows, and receive blessings from family and friends. Betrothal ceremonies create a foundation for a lifelong partnership, strengthening the bond between the couple and their community.

Retirement Ceremonies

Retirement ceremonies are heartfelt celebrations that honour an individual’s contributions and achievements throughout their career. These ceremonies mark the end of a professional journey and the beginning of a new chapter in life. They offer an opportunity to reflect on years of hard work, express gratitude, and share memories with colleagues, friends, and family. Retirement ceremonies create a meaningful space to acknowledge a legacy and embrace the exciting possibilities of the future.

Crone Ceremonies

Crone ceremonies celebrate the transition into the later stages of life, honouring wisdom, experience, and the rich journey of aging. These ceremonies acknowledge the deep knowledge and contributions of older women, marking a time of reflection and renewed purpose. They offer a space to honour personal achievements, share stories, and embrace the newfound freedom and insights that come with this stage of life, celebrating the strength and grace of the crone.

House Blessings

House blessings are meaningful ceremonies that celebrate and sanctify a new home or living space. They mark the beginning of a new chapter, infusing the space with positive energy and good fortune. During these ceremonies, participants may offer prayers, share wishes, and perform rituals to promote harmony and happiness. House blessings create a warm, welcoming environment, turning a house into a cherished home filled with love and protection.
